Thermodynamic System:-
• A definite quantity of matter on which we
  focus our attention for its thermodynamic
  analysis i.e., to study the change in properties
  due to exchange of energy in the form of heat
  annd work is called thermodynamic system
• The system may be a quantity of steam, a
  mixture of gas and vapour or a piston cylinder
  assembly of an internal combustion engine.
• System:-Anything which are kept in
  consideration is called -
                          System.
• Surrounding:-Everything external to the system
  is known as Surrounding.
• Boundary:-The thermodynamic system and
  surroundings are separated by an envelope
  called Boundary of a system.
• Universe:-Thermodynamic
  system+surrounding=Universe
Classification of
      Thermodynamic system
• Open system:-in open system, the mass as
  well as energy transfer may take place
  between system and its surroundings.
• Most of Engineering devices are open system.
Example of open system:-
•   Internal combustion engines
•   Air compressor
•   Water pump
•   Steam engine
•   Boiler
•   Tutbine
Closed system:-
*In closed system, the mass with in the
boundary of the system remains constant
and only the energy transfer may take place
between the system and its surroundings.
        Examples of closed system
 1.Pressure cooker
 2.A rubber balloon filled with air and tightly
 closed
 3.The gas confined between a piston and
 cylinder
Isolated system:-
*In an isolated system,neither mass nor
energy transfer takes place between the
system and its surroundings.

      Examples of isolated system


  1.Thermos flask
  2.The universe
